Overview

The Woodhead LITE-A-SITE® Socket/Guard Assembly (STR104) is a rugged industrial lighting component designed for A21 bulb sizes up to 100W. This assembly features a durable rubber handle and an 8-gauge zinc-plated steel guard for maximum bulb and electrical component protection. It supports a maximum voltage of 240V and is configured for NEMA 5-15 outlets. The closed-end guard style ensures safety in demanding work environments. CSA certified (LR85374), this assembly is ideal for portable lighting applications requiring reliable and safe illumination. Manufactured in the US.

Frequently Asked Questions about Woodhead

What certifications and standards do Woodhead products comply with?

Woodhead products are certified to multiple rigorous industrial standards, including UL Listed, CSA Certified, NSF Certified, and IP69K Rated. Their wiring devices meet FDA compliance requirements for food-related applications, and are tested to international standards like JIS Z2801/ISO 22196 for antimicrobial performance. These certifications demonstrate Woodhead's commitment to safety, durability, and quality across industrial, food processing, and harsh environment applications.

What industries and applications are Woodhead products used for?

Woodhead products serve a wide range of industrial applications including manufacturing, construction sites, food and beverage processing, shipyards, utility plants, and maintenance operations. Their specialized wiring devices and outlet boxes are designed for harsh environments like wet locations, petrochemical facilities, and heavy-duty industrial settings, with specific product lines for assembly stations, workstations, and portable power needs.
